## Step 4: Sorting stability

Fenwick Reports 3.x switches to a stable sort for all report columns. Rows with equal keys now keep insertion order instead of arbitrary order. Snapshot tests comparing row order will need regeneration. Verify any custom comparators are transitive before merging. The sort-related settings introduced by this step are shown below.

deployment values, kajep-kageg:
[praix]
host = praix.paliqcorp.corp
user = praix_svc
database = praix_prod

## Wellness Room — Booking Access (Brindle House, Level 2)

Wellness Room 2B is bookable in 30-minute blocks via the Quietly app. Facilities desk confirms bookings and resets the door after each session. No walk-ins during peak hours (11:00–14:00). Cleaning runs at 08:00 and 16:00; block those slots. If the app is down, log the booking manually in the Brindle House register and escalate to the duty lead. The room unlocks with the standard override pass. Use the code below to release the door.

door code, kawip-bagap: bdg-HQEWH-4

## Onboarding: Currency Conversion & Rounding at Pellwick Systems

Our Minthollow service converts balances across currencies using banker's rounding to avoid cumulative drift. Security reviewers should note that rounding discrepancies above half a cent trigger the reconciliation queue, which is access-controlled. To audit reconciliation records you'll need the sealed reviewer credentials stored in the Coffershed vault. Access requires manager approval plus the standing recovery passphrase, which is listed below for completeness.

vault phrase of bagaf-kajeg = jorath-feniel-briir-siliel-ralix